Hélene Cattet and Bruno Forzani’s spellbinding giallo homage
AMER has finally been announced for U.S. DVD and Blu-ray release. Read on for
the details and to check out the covers.
Olive Films has revealed an October 4 street date for AMER, which follows its heroine at three ages (as a little girl, a teenager and an adult woman) dealing with the terrors of family, sexuality and a mysterious stalker. Utilizing a highly stylized camera technique and color palette, and with a soundtrack of themes from past Italian classics by Ennio Morricone, Stelvio Cipriani and Bruno Nicolai, AMER will be presented in 2.35:1 widescreen with the following special features:
• The first five films by Cattet and Forzani, with notes from the filmmakers:
-CATHARSIS (2001)
-CHAMBRE JAUNE (2002)
-LA FIN DE NOTRE AMOUR(2003)
-L’ETRANGE PORTRAIT DE LE DAME EN JAUNE (2004)
-SANTOS PALACE (2006)
• Two theatrical trailers
• Theatrical teaser
Retail prices are $29.95 for the DVD, $34.95 for the Blu-ray. See our review of AMER here and visit the movie’s official website.
